    1. Oregon police sergeant on how to find drugged drivers
      from RNZ
      Critics of the cannabis legalisation bill are concerned about how drug driving will be controlled on New Zealand streets if the drug is legalised in next year's referendum. A police sergeant in the US state of Oregon says officers use a combination of clinical testing and looking for cognitive deficits when determining impairment in drug drivers. The state legalised the use and possession of recreational cannabis, for those over 21, in 2015. Corin Dann speaks to Oregon State Police sergeant Evan Sether, who is a drug recognition expert.
